A very stylish car with a great ride. A very spacious interior - great for big people. Parts cost about twice as much as for a domestic car - brutal. For example, new exhaust and catalytic converter $850 US. At 100K miles, the front shocks are going, the transmission takes a while to get into reverse and 2 air sensors have been recently replaced. Handles very well in snow for a RW drive. I'd keep this car if I could afford the repair and maintenance costs.
